		<description>[...] Mergers and acquisitions in Turkey&#8217;s insurance world are continuing at full speed. Brisk trade continues after Spanish Mapfre&#8217;s takeover of Genel Sigorta and Austrian TBIH Financial Services&#8217; buyout of Ray Sigorta.  Dutch insurance company Euroko B.V., which does business exceeding 14 billion euros and serving approximately 7 million customers, purchased 80 percent of Garanti Sigorta A.Ş. and 15 percent of Garanti Emeklilik ve Hayat A.Ş., a pension fund. Another merger includes the Pension fund Ak Emeklilik, a subsidiary of Sabancı Holding, and Aviva Hayat ve Emeklilik. According to the press releases, Euroko B.V. purchased 80 percent of Garanti Sigorta for 365 million euros and 15 percent of Garanti Emeklilik for 100 million euros. [...]</description>
